A crypto sniper bot is a trading bot that specializes in grabbing opportunities the moment they appear on any platform. Just like your personal assistant, who doesn't sleep or take rest, but monitors the market 24/7 and acts quicker than a human.

These are the famous sniper bots. They constantly keep an eye on the blockchain mempools for new token listings and buy them instantly. Say, for example, when a new meme coin launches on Uniswap, the sniper bot would grab it in a matter of seconds, and that too at a lower price.
The type of bots would utilize the price difference that occurs between exchanges. For instance, if a token is priced at $1 on Uniswap, but in Sushiswap, it would have been listed for $1.50. The arbitrage sniper bot identifies this opportunity and buys it at a cheaper price in one exchange, then sells it for a higher price on another. By doing this, traders can easily gain consistent profits.
These bots carefully monitor the events in the liquidity pools. For example, when a large liquidity provider adds tokens to a pool, the price can shift rapidly. A liquidity sniper bot detects this activity and executes trades even before other traders would identify the price movement!

For effective operation, a sniper bot needs more than just speed. The best ones are packed with both performance-oriented and security-focused features. Below is a list of core features of a crypto sniper bot.
Key Feature | What is it? |
---|---|
Real-Time Market Data Integration | A sniper bot monitors the live blockchain and exchanges data, and ensures it never misses an opportunity. |
Automated Order Execution Engine | The bot places buy and sell orders instantly to meet the moment the expected conditions are met. |
Gas Optimization | The most attractive aspect of sniper bots is that they compete with other bots; speed matters. So, these sniper bots use a gas fee optimization strategy, like paying a higher fee to push their transactions ahead of others. |
Multi-Wallet Support | These bots operate across various wallets, which ultimately increases the trading volume. |
Security Protocols | Security is the most important aspect of bots, due to the involvement of money. So, strong encryption and security protocols are essential to avoid hacks and data theft. |
Risk Management & Stop-Loss Features | There is no guarantee that every trade will go as planned. Sometimes, it ends in profit, and at times, there are losses as well. Risk control measures like stop-loss orders safeguard traders from huge losses. |
Sniper bots' working ideology might seem complex at first, but when it is broken down, it is quite simple to understand.
It constantly analyzes the blockchain’s mempool, which is a waiting hall where pending transactions stay before they get confirmed. And through this, the bot would identify activities like new token listing.
Based on the previous rules provided, such as “ conduct trade when the price difference is below 1.05%”. Then the bot would sense it as a profitable opportunity.
The bot submits a transaction in a fraction of a second, and often uses higher gas fees to ensure it processes the trades much before competitors can.
Once the selected trade is executed, the bot confirms it on the blockchain and then updates the trader’s wallet balance as well.
Some sniper bots do more than just buy before the crowd. They also keep track of token performance and sell it once the targeted profit level is reached!

Yes, sniper bots are beneficial, but building and using them comes with a few challenges as well!
Most of the traders run sniper bots. But the success rate is pretty low, as only a few of the traders’ transactions are processed. This leaves the other participants in failed trades.
In a busy network like Ethereum, trade wars can erupt as multiple bots try to compete with each other. And this makes transactions very expensive in such cases.
Bots always need wallet access, so a poorly coded bot can expose private keys. And it can lead to hacking, data theft, and other malware attacks.
Scams are very common in areas like NFT marketplaces. New tokens are launched just to confuse and trick the bots. A sniper bot might buy it instantly without knowing it is a scam. Thus leading to rug pull risks.
